First, let's look at what Newsbusters had to say about some of the local media's attacks on Hy:

The local NBC affiliate, WGRZ took the side of Buffalo Public Schools immediately by first publishing BPP’s response to the allegations over 24-hours before reporting on the allegations themselves. On April 26 at 8:48 p.m., they published this report titled: “BPS says it's 'prepared to vigorously address these untruths' made in online video.” It took them until 11:17 p.m. on April 27 to publish an article titled: “Police officer alleges Buffalo Public Schools abuse cover-up.”

As for the local CBS affiliate, WIVB, they spilled a bunch of ink attacking Hy’s history as a Buffalo Police officer. 227 of their 714-word report (almost 32 percent) were spent on trying to smear Hy rather than grill the school district.

not every media outlet covered itself in crap instead of glory. Newsbusters noted one that seemed interested in actually covering the story:

Buffalo-based radio station WBEN went a different path by actually speaking with a parent who sided with Hy. “I am thankful that that Detective [Richard Hy] came forward. The district has a history of covering up. I deal with a lot of special ed parents and we have a lot of problems in Special Ed where students are placed in improper classrooms. This doesn't surprise me one bit,” the station quoted parent Ed Speidel.

Speidel had another story to share about alleged misconduct by BPS: “I know of a mom who reported her young child was assaulted by a substitute teacher and the district will not give the teacher's name, so that the mom can press charges. It's disturbing the lack of transparency that comes out of Buffalo Public Schools.”

New details on Buffalo detective’s accusations of coverups of abuse at Buffalo Public Schools..

Buffalo Police SVU Detective Richard Hy.. said that Cronin tried to abduct two children at the elementary school, a girl and a boy, but that the school never told the boy’s family about the abduction attempt against him.

He also said that there’s evidence that the school erased surveillance video of the incident, but that someone at the school took cell phone video of that incident and gave it investigators.
